A bar chart showing the number of low-income households in the UK in millions going without the essentials from May 2022 - October 2024. This number has stayed around 7 million the whole time.
Latest research from Oct finds around 7 million low-income households are still going without essentials. 📢
This number has barely moved for three years.
5.4 million low-income households said they were unable to afford enough food in the past 30 days.
